EXHIBIT 99(v)


     NOTE PURCHASE OPTION AGREEMENT, dated as of June 1, 2001 (this
"Agreement"), among CGU International Holdings Luxembourg S.A., a Luxembourg
corporation, CGU Holdings LLC, a Delaware limited liability company (each a
"Noteholder," which term shall include any person who becomes a Noteholder in
accordance with Section 4.2 hereof) and White Mountains Insurance Group, Ltd., a
company existing under the laws of Bermuda (the "Optionee").

     WHEREAS, pursuant to a Stock Purchase Agreement dated as of September 24,
2000 by and among CGU International Holdings Luxembourg S.A., CGU Holdings LLC
(each a "Seller"), CGNU plc, the Optionee, TACK Holding Corp. (the "Note
Issuer") and TACK Acquisition Corp., as amended by Amendment No. 1 thereto dated
as of October 15, 2000 and by Amendment No. 2 thereto dated as of February 20,
2001 (as amended, the "Stock Purchase Agreement"), the Note Issuer issued to the
Sellers subordinated promissory notes due November 29, 2002 (the "Maturity
Date") (such promissory notes and any other like promissory note that may be
issued by the Note Issuer in replacement or upon transfer (whether in whole or
in part) of any of them, or of any such other promissory note, and that shall be
outstanding are each referred to herein as a "Note") in the aggregate principal
amount of $260,000,000.00;

     WHEREAS, Exhibit G to the Stock Purchase Agreement contemplates that each
of the Sellers would grant the Optionee an option to purchase the Notes issued
to such Seller from such Seller (or any person to whom such Seller or any
transferee of such Seller may transfer such Note) on the terms and subject to
the conditions set forth in such Exhibit G; and

     WHEREAS, in accordance with their respective obligations undertaken in the
Stock Purchase Agreement, including Exhibit G thereto, each Seller desires to
grant to the Optionee, and the Optionee desires to accept from each Seller, an
option to purchase such Seller's Note on the terms and subject to the conditions
set forth herein;

     N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the covenants and agreements contained
in this Agreement, the parties hereto agree as follows:


                                    ARTICLE I
                                   THE OPTION

     SECTION 1.1 OBLIGATION TO SELL. On the terms and subject to the conditions
of this Agreement, each Noteholder hereby grants the Optionee an option to
purchase the Notes held by such Noteholder. On the Maturity Date, if the
Optionee shall have delivered an Exercise Notice (as defined below) to the
Noteholders in accordance with Section 1.2 hereof, then subject to satisfaction
of the conditions set forth in Article III hereof, each Noteholder shall sell to
the Optionee, and the Optionee shall purchase from each Noteholder, for the
consideration specified in Section 1.3 hereof, the Notes held by such Noteholder
specified in such Exercise Notice or such lesser portion thereof as may be
determined pursuant to Section 1.5 hereof.

     SECTION 1.2 EXERCISE NOTICE. If the Optionee desires to purchase the Notes
as provided in this Agreement, the Optionee shall deliver to each Noteholder a
notice (the "Exercise







Notice") not less than 10 days before the Maturity Date and not more than 90
days before the Maturity Date, specifying (i) that the Optionee has elected to
purchase the Notes in accordance with this Agreement and (ii) the amount of
consideration that is payable by the Optionee.

     SECTION 1.3 CONSIDERATION. The consideration payable by the Optionee upon
purchase of any Note shall consist of a number of common shares of the Optionee
("Common Shares") equal to the Number of Shares Issuable (as defined below).
Such Common Shares when issued shall be validly issued, fully paid and
non-assessable and free and clear of all liens. The "Number of Shares Issuable"
shall be a number (rounded to the nearest whole number) determined by dividing
the principal amount of the Note to be purchased, plus accrued and unpaid
interest thereon calculated in accordance with the provisions of the Notes, by
the Per Share Price as of the Maturity Date; PROVIDED, HOWEVER, that any
calculation of Number of Shares Issuable shall be made without any reduction for
any and all present or future taxes, levies, imposts, deductions, charges or
withholdings, and all liabilities with respect thereto. The "Per Share Price"
initially shall be $245 per share, subject to adjustment pursuant to Article II
hereof.

     SECTION 2.1 ADJUSTMENT OF PER SHARE PRICE; NUMBER OF SHARES ISSUABLE. The
Per Share Price shall be subject to adjustment from time to time from and after
the date of this Agreement through the Maturity Date in the applicable manner,
and upon the occurrence of any of the events, enumerated in this Section 2.1.

     (a) SHARE DIVIDENDS, SUBDIVISIONS, RECLASSIFICATIONS, COMBINATIONS. If the
Optionee declares a dividend or makes a distribution on its outstanding Common
Shares in Common Shares, or subdivides or reclassifies its outstanding Common
Shares into a greater number of Common Shares, or combines its outstanding
Common Shares into a smaller number of Common Shares, then, in each such event,

                                       -3-





          (i) the then applicable Per Share Price shall be adjusted so that the
     Noteholders shall be entitled to receive, upon the exercise by the Optionee
     of its option hereunder, the number of Common Shares which such Noteholder
     would have been entitled to receive immediately after the happening of any
     of the events described above had such option been exercised immediately
     prior to the happening of such event or the record date therefor, whichever
     is earlier; and

          (ii) an adjustment to the Per Share Price made pursuant to this clause
     (a) shall become effective (A) in the case of any such dividend or
     distribution, immediately after the close of business on the record date
     for the determination of holders of Common Shares entitled to receive such
     dividend or distribution or (B) in the case of any such subdivision,
     reclassification or combination, at the close of business on the day upon
     which such corporate action becomes effective.

     (h) ADJUSTMENTS. No adjustments in the Per Share Price shall be made unless
such adjustment would result in an adjustment of more than 1% in the Per Share
Price; PROVIDED, HOWEVER, that any adjustments that by reason of this paragraph
(h) are not made shall be carried forward and taken into account in any
subsequent adjustment.

     (i) DEFINED TERMS. As used in this Section 2.1, the following terms shall
have the following meanings:

     "CONVERTIBLE SECURITIES" means any rights, warrants, options or other
securities directly or indirectly convertible into or exercisable or
exchangeable for Common Shares, other than any Permitted Issuances.

     "DETERMINATION DATE" means, with respect to the making of any issuance,
dividend or distribution as to which a record or other date is fixed for the
determination of holders of Common Shares entitled to receive or participate in
such issuance, dividend or distribution, the earlier of (i) such record or other
date and (ii) the first date on which the Common Shares trade regular way on the
principal securities exchange or market on which they are traded without the
right to receive such issuance, dividend or distribution.

     "FAIR MARKET VALUE" means, as of any date, with respect to a Common Share,
the average of the closing prices of a Common Share for the ten consecutive
trading days immediately prior to the determination date or, if the Common
Shares are not listed or admitted to trade on any national securities exchange,
the fair market value per share as determined in good faith by the Board of
Directors of the Optionee in reliance upon an opinion of a nationally recognized
investment bank and certified in a resolution sent to each Noteholder.

     "PERMITTED ISSUANCE" means (a) any shares, warrants, options, rights or
other securities of the Optionee outstanding on the date hereof (and the
issuance of any Common Shares upon the exercise or conversion thereof), (b) any
Common Shares issued upon exercise of the Warrants, (c) any share options or
other securities of the Optionee granted pursuant to any employee benefit plan
or program of the Optionee and any Common Shares or other securities of the
Optionee issued upon exercise thereof, (d) any securities of the Optionee issued
in consideration for the acquisition of a business and (e) any public offering
of any securities of the Optionee, other than pursuant to or in connection with
an issuance of rights, options or warrants to all holders of Common Shares of
the Optionee entitling them to subscribe for or purchase Common Shares.

     "WARRANTS" means the warrants to purchase 1,714,285 Common Shares sold
pursuant to the Warrant Agreement among the Optionee and Berkshire Hathaway
Inc., dated as of May 31, 2001.
